A new compound from the marine-derived Streptomyces sp. SS13M
Yong-Jun Jiang1, Yuan-Yuan Ji1, Jia-Qi Li1
1Institute of Marine Biology, Ocean College, Zhejiang University, Zhoushan 316021, China.
Abstract:
As part of our efforts toward search for structurally new and bioactive natural products from marine-derived microorganisms, one new compound (1) was characterized from a marine-derived actinomycete Streptomyces sp. SS13M. The structure of new compound was elucidated by the analysis of HRESIMS, 1D, and 2D NMR spectroscopic data, and the absolute configuration was determined by ECD calculations.[Formula: see text].
